Understanding Web Hosting and Domains
For anyone looking to establish an online presence, understanding the fundamental concepts of web hosting and domain names is paramount. Hidrawear.com Review
They are the two non-negotiable components that allow your website to be accessible to anyone with an internet connection.
Think of them as the land and the address for your online property.
What is Web Hosting?
Web hosting is essentially the service that allows individuals and organizations to post a website or web page onto the Internet.
A web host, or hosting service provider, is a business that provides the technologies and services needed for the website or webpage to be viewed in the Internet.
Websites are hosted, or stored, on special computers called servers. Arkbuild.london Review
- The Server: A server is a powerful computer that stores your website’s files HTML, CSS, images, videos, databases and makes them available to internet users. When someone types your website address into their browser, the server “serves” those files to their computer, displaying your site.
- Key Function: Continuous availability and responsiveness to user requests.
- Types of Web Hosting:
- Shared Hosting: The most common and affordable type. Your website shares server resources CPU, RAM, disk space with many other websites. Ideal for small websites and blogs with moderate traffic.
- Pros: Low cost, easy to set up.
- Cons: Performance can be affected by other sites on the same server “noisy neighbor effect”.
- VPS Hosting Virtual Private Server: A step up from shared hosting. A single physical server is partitioned into multiple virtual servers, each with its own dedicated resources. You get more control and better performance than shared hosting.
- Pros: More resources, better performance, root access, scalable.
- Cons: More expensive than shared, requires some technical knowledge to manage.
- Dedicated Hosting: You get an entire physical server exclusively for your website. Provides maximum power, control, and performance. Best for large websites with high traffic or complex applications.
- Pros: Full control, maximum performance, enhanced security.
- Cons: Most expensive, requires significant technical expertise to manage.
- Cloud Hosting: Leverages a network of interconnected servers. Your website’s data is spread across multiple servers, and if one server fails, another takes over. Highly scalable and reliable.
- Pros: High uptime, scalability, pay-as-you-go pricing model.
- Cons: Can be complex to configure, costs can fluctuate based on usage.
- WordPress Hosting: Optimized specifically for WordPress websites. Can be shared, VPS, or dedicated, but configured for optimal WordPress performance, security, and updates.
- Pros: Faster WordPress sites, enhanced security, often includes WordPress-specific support.
- Cons: Typically more expensive than generic shared hosting.
- Reseller Hosting: Allows you to purchase hosting space and resources, and then “resell” them to your own clients, making it ideal for web developers or agencies.

What is a Domain Name?
A domain name is your website’s unique address on the internet.
It’s what people type into their browser to find your website e.g., google.com, extremecode.lk. Without a domain name, people would have to remember a series of numbers an IP address to access your site, which is impractical.
- Unique Identifier: Just like a physical address for a house, a domain name is a unique identifier for your website. No two websites can have the same domain name.
- Structure of a Domain Name:
- Top-Level Domain TLD: This is the last part of the domain name, such as .com, .org, .net, .gov, .edu, or country-code TLDs like .lk Sri Lanka. .com is the most popular and generally recommended for businesses.
- Data Point: As of Q1 2023, there were over 350 million domain name registrations across all TLDs globally, with .com dominating at over 160 million registrations Verisign Domain Name Industry Brief.
- Second-Level Domain SLD: This is the unique name you choose for your website, typically representing your brand or business e.g., “extremecode” in extremecode.lk.

- Domain Name System DNS: When you type a domain name into your browser, the DNS translates that human-readable domain name into the numerical IP address of the server where your website is hosted. This is how your browser knows where to find your website’s files.
- Domain Registration: Domain names are registered through domain registrars companies accredited by ICANN – Internet Corporation for Assigned Names and Numbers. You typically register a domain for a specific period e.g., 1-10 years and renew it to maintain ownership.
How Hosting and Domains Work Together
Think of your website as a house:
- Web Hosting is the land where your house website files is built and stored.
- The Domain Name is the street address of your house.
You need both for your website to be live and accessible.
You purchase hosting space on a server, and you register a unique domain name. Elitegymequipment.company.site Review
Then, you “point” your domain name to your hosting server’s IP address through DNS settings.
This tells the internet where to find your website when someone enters your domain name.
Without this connection, even if your website files are on a server, no one can find them.
